Greatest Hits is a collection of songs by American new wave band Devo, released in 1990. The album includes several photos from previous albums, and the first half of an article on the band by Howie Klein. The second half of this article appears in the accompanying material for Devo's Greatest Misses.

Personnel

Devo

Technical

  • Devo – producer (1, 2, 5, 7, 15), co-producer (9–11, 14)
  • Ivan Ivan – remixing (1)
  • Roy Thomas Baker – producer (3, 4, 6)
  • Brian Eno – producer (8, 13, 16)
  • Robert Margouleff – co-producer (9–11, 14)
  • Ken Scott – producer, engineer (12)
  • Kathe Duba-Noland – album compilation
  • Gerald Casale – album compilation, art devotion
  • Mark Mothersbaugh – album compilation
  • Tim Stedman – art devotion
  • Alex Remlyn – devography
  • General Boy – liner notes
  • Howie Klein – liner notes
  • Janet Perr – photography
  • Karen Filter – photography
  • Effective Graphics – computer graphics
